Why Gutter Repair Is Especially Important on the Gulf Coast 

Gulf Coast weather puts gutters through constant stress. Heavy rainfall, tropical storms, hurricane-force winds, and year-round humidity can all shorten the lifespan of a gutter system if problems aren't addressed promptly.

Damaged gutters can allow water to overflow or collect around your home's foundation, increasing the risk of erosion, wood rot, mold growth, and structural damage. Moisture can also affect your fascia and soffit, creating additional repair needs if left untreated.

Scheduling timely repairs helps homeowners:


  • Prevent water damage to the roof and foundation
  • Reduce the risk of mold and mildew caused by excess moisture
  • Protect landscaping from washouts
  • Extend the life of the existing gutter system
  • Prepare the home for hurricane season and severe weather


Catching small problems early often prevents much larger and more expensive repairs later.

Signs You Need Gutter Repair 

Many gutter problems begin gradually before becoming obvious. Watching for early warning signs can help you avoid significant water damage.


Common indicators include:

  • Gutters pulling away from the home
  • Water dripping from seams or corners
  • Sagging or uneven gutter sections
  • Overflow during rainstorms
  • Rust, corrosion, or visible holes
  • Standing water near the foundation
  • Downspouts that are loose, clogged, or damaged
  • Peeling paint or water stains near the roofline
  • Fascia boards showing signs of rot or deterioration


If you notice any of these issues, scheduling a professional inspection can help determine whether a repair is all that's needed.

Should You Repair or Replace Your Gutters?

Not every damaged gutter system needs complete replacement. In many cases, targeted repairs can restore performance and extend the life of your existing gutters.

Repair is often the right solution when:


  • Damage is isolated to one area
  • Small leaks are present
  • A few fasteners have loosened
  • Downspouts need repair or replacement
  • The overall system remains structurally sound


A gutter replacement may be recommended when:

  • Multiple sections are failing
  • Extensive rust or corrosion is present
  • Gutters have widespread separation or sagging
  • Storm damage affects large portions of the system
  • The existing gutters no longer handle heavy rainfall effectively


Our team will inspect your gutters and provide honest recommendations based on the condition of your system.
